Assassinations

Assassinations taken place at a WHS having killed one or more notable persons.

World Heritage Sites connected to 'Assassinations':

  • Canterbury (The Crypt) St Thomas Becket (Dec 29 1170)
  • Chief Roi Mata's Domain Roy Mata was poisened by his brother.
  • Fontainebleau Marchese Gian Rinaldo Monaldeschi (10 February 1657)
  • Lima Pizarro's Palace (Now Government Palace in the main square) - Pizarro (June 26 1541)
  • Loire Valley (Ch?teau de Blois) Henry I, Duke of Guise (December 23, 1588)
  • Matobo Hills Assassination of Mlimo by Frederick Russell Burnham in one of the Matobo caves in 1896
  • Paramaribo (Courtyard of Fort Zeelandia) 15 Opposition leaders ("Decembermoorden" Dec 8 1982)
  • Prague (Saint) John of Nepomuk was thrown into the river from Charles Bridge (1393). Plus First Defenestration (1419), resulting in the death of several people including the Mayor. Plus: Cernin Palace - the Czech Foreign Ministry. 10 Mar 1948 Jan Masaryk (the only non communist in the Soviet installed government) was found dead in the courtyard under the bathroom window. At the time it was claimed to be a "suicide". Subsequent investigations have been unclear but the probability is assassination.
  • Rome (Forum near East Portico) Julius Caesar (Mar 15 44BC)
  • Spissky Hrad & Levoca In a lurid sequence of events in 1700, the mayor of Levoca was accidentally wounded by a local nobleman during a hunt, generating a series of revenge attacks, finally resulting in the murder of the mayor, Karol Kramler, a Saxon magistrate.
  • St. Petersburg (Yusupov Palace) Rasputin (Dec 16 1916)
  • Tower of London The Princes Edward and Richard (1483)
  • Vatican City Numerous famous assassinations (real of suspected), the last one being on May 4 1998, when the head of the Swiss Guard, Alois Estermann, his wife and a vice-corporal, Cedric Tornay, have been found dead killed by shotgun. The circumstances of this killing are still subjected to many speculations.
  • Westminster (Westminster Palace) British Prime Minister Spencer Perceval was assassinated by John Bellingham in the lobby of the House of Commons (1812); British MP Airey Neve was assassinated by IRA terrorists in the Palace of Westminster Mar 1979
  • White Monuments of Vladimir and Suzdal Prince Andrei Bugolyubsky - "Great Prince Andrei spent 17 years of his reign in Bogolyubovo before he was murdered in 1174." (wiki)
